The manager hails great level and sacrifice by players
Fernando Vazquez has met the press euforic after the first league win. The dressing room was chuffed after breaking this really bad run and dubbed the victory as “needed” and even “balsamic”. The manager in this sense has given heavy importance to these three points as they come beating a great rival who is “profilic at scoring, extremely dangerous upfront and always complicated. To leave the most prolific rival goalless is an achievement and we have to go back home very proud. Clean sheet, many chances for us – we were good today”.
The Galician sees the team bridging “closer to where we want to be. This week we play Thursday and then Sunday. It will be the beginning of a great week, hopefully.” He loves the solidity of the team’s defence and how the team controls it on the pitch, “and if we can keeping the ball, even better. We are doing it, without hassle, we just have to improve when we do not own the ball, at those stages”.
Vazquez guaranteed the players give their all and “today they have shown their level. I am so satisfied”. The manager also mentioned that in case of winning the remaining game in the week we “would have gone past the bad start” and it is possible that given the many games in few days, rotation is “a concern as I have to check how players are faring”.
Finally, the reminded everyone about how level the division is, “budgets are practically the same, squad as well. It is a competition where three points are hard to clinch. We need to be more spot on than the rival. Goals do not come easy and it applies to us too”, he concluded.
